Integrated built-in speaker with conduit
A technology with built-in speakers and conduits, which is applied in the direction of frequency/direction characteristic devices, etc., can solve the problems of small cavity volume, dry and not full sound, poor low frequency response, etc., and achieve the effect of good low frequency expansion

[0011] As shown in the figure: the woofer unit 2 provided on the speaker casing 1 is provided with a conduit 9 connected at both ends in the speaker casing 1, and the sound outlet 4 of the conduit 9 is on the side close to the woofer unit 2, The sound inlet opening 8 of the duct 9 is on the side away from the woofer unit 2, the sound inlet opening 8 of the duct 9 communicates with the inner cavity 7 of the sound box housing 1, and the inner cavity 7 is also communicated with the woofer unit 2, the duct The orientation of the sound outlet opening 4 of the duct is consistent with that of the woofer unit 2, and the sound outlet opening 4 of the duct is connected to the outside air.
[0012] The sound outlet opening 4 of the duct 9 is preferably arranged on the side directly below the woofer unit 2 and close to the woofer unit 2, and the sound inlet opening 8 of the duct 9 is preferably arranged directly below the woofer unit 2 and away from the woofer unit.
